Abstract

The invention discloses and provides a preprocessing process of a linen-cotton blended fabric, and belongs to a process of processing the linen-cotton blended fabric by sufficiently using laccase and xylanase and cooperating tea saponin. The process has the advantages that cloth surface hemp fimble stem-fiber can be effectively removed; in addition, safety and environment protection are realized; in addition, the whiteness is high; the fabric strength is high; the handfeel is softer and smoother. The process comprises the following steps of preparing processing liquid from tea saponin, fibroin, laccase, xylanase and the balance water; putting linen-cotton blended single jersey into the processing liquid; maintaining the temperature to be 45 DEG C to 52 DEG C for acting for 28min to 40 min; then, boiling the materials for 5min at 90 DEG C for enzyme deactivation processing; cleanly washing and drying the materials.

Background technology
Linen fibre is one of natural plant fibre of using the earliest of the mankind, and its natural, ancient, noble and high-quality, is described as " fiber queen " by people.And lingerie is subject to the favor of people deeply with its natural stype of recovering one's original simplicity and natural, graceful and poised elegant noble quality, it has well-pressed, nice and cool, good hygroscopicity, be not stained with skin and health care, the multiple sanitation performance such as antibacterial, antistatic, Long-Time Service is useful to human body, is regarded as green health articles for use.Flax is the Cortical fiber of plant, and its function is the skin of approximating anatomy, has protection human body, regulates the natural performances such as temperature.Namely flax and skin contact form capillarity, are the extensions of skin.This natural gas permeability, hygroscopicity, salubrious property and the perspiration discharging performance of flax, become the textiles freely breathed.
Flax textile has good hygroscopicity, without features such as electrostatic, high, the anti-corruption of stretching resistance are heat-resisting, dark liking by consumers in general.But, because linen fibre is impure many compared with cotton fiber, particularly contained lignin is that cotton fiber is unexistent, and thus the pre-treatment of sodolin is just more difficult.For this reason, people starts to have carried out primary study to the pre-treatment auxiliary agent of Flax Cotton Blended knit fabric produced and technique.
Prior art finds, only numb skin cannot be disposed with Tea Saponin process for Flax Cotton Blended fabric, needs jointly to use could thoroughly remove with hydrogen peroxide.But hydrogen peroxide easily damages fabric, inadequate environmental protection.
The present invention aims to provide a kind of pretreating process of new flax-cotton blend fabric, make full use of the technique of laccase, zytase, collaborative Tea Saponin process flax-cotton blend fabric, described technique effectively can remove cloth cover fiber crops skin, and safety and environmental protection, and whiteness is high, fabric intensity is high, and feel is also more a softer and smoother touch.
Summary of the invention
Based on the technical problem that background technology exists, the present invention is directed to background technology Problems existing, a kind of pretreating process of new flax-cotton blend fabric is provided, make full use of the technique of laccase, zytase, collaborative Tea Saponin process flax-cotton blend fabric, described technique effectively can remove cloth cover fiber crops skin, and safety and environmental protection, and whiteness is high, fabric intensity is high, and feel is also more a softer and smoother touch.
Tea Saponin is a natural plant kind non-ionic surface active agent, good removal effect is all had to grease wax, pectin substance, ash, cotton seed hulls, numb skin etc. in cotton, flax fibre, especially there is the splendid characteristic penetrated to lignin inside, lignin is able to fully expanded, thus lignin is under the synergy of oxidant, fully degraded, therefore in sodolin numb skin process in show extraordinary effect.

Claims (3)

1. a preprocess method for flax-cotton blend fabric, its step is as follows:
(1) raw material is prepared: choose Flax Cotton Blended single jersey;
(2) configuration process liquid:
Configure according to following mass percent:
Tea Saponin 5-8%
Fibroin 1%
Laccase 0.5-0.8%
Zytase 0.3-0.5%
All the other are water;
Mixed in a reservoir by all the components, the pH value being adjusted to requirement is 4.5;
(3) fabric process: dropped in treatment fluid by Flax Cotton Blended single jersey, keeps temperature 45 C-52 DEG C effect 28min-40min, then carries out 90 DEG C and boils 5min and carry out going out ferment treatment, clean and dry.
